Multiple reviews note clean rooms and bathrooms and good hygiene ('room and bathroom were clean and comfortable', 'hygiene en comfortabele bedden').
Staff repeatedly described as friendly and extremely helpful at reception and throughout the stay, though there are isolated service issues (billing/currency confusion and limited English at times).
Location is convenient and on a main road; reviewers called it 'good' but noted it's in a more business district, a bit away from main shopping/Thamel and may require taxis.
Rooms and suites praised as comfortable and relaxing (Royal Suite highlighted), with good in-room facilities and vibe.
Facilities and amenities are frequently praised (superb facilities, cultural dance show, good entertainment), though some guests noted scruffy areas and a very cold/unusable pool.
Most guests felt the hotel was excellent value, but a notable billing/currency dispute and some expectations around inclusions slightly reduced perceived value for a few guests.
Food and restaurant receive strong positive mentions (local cuisine praised, good restaurant), while breakfast was described as average or somewhat sparse/cold by some guests.
Overall impressions are very positive—many reviewers call it an amazing or best-ever stay, recommending the hotel and praising staff, comfort and atmosphere.

I travel for work several times a year and stay in many hotels, so I don't say this lightly: Basera is one of the best places I have ever stayed. The staff are the reason. They are unfailingly courteous, and they go well beyond what any guest could reasonably expect. My flights into Kathmandu almost always land early in the morning, and every single time the team has arranged for my room to be ready so I could check in and rest instead of waiting until the afternoon. That kind of consistency is rare anywhere. The building itself is a pleasure. It is built in traditional Nepalese style, with carved woodwork and brickwork that give the place real character, and the atmosphere is calm even though you are in the middle of the city. The rooms are genuinely comfortable, well laid out and quiet, and the housekeeping is impeccable. I have never once found anything out of place. The restaurants deserve a mention of their own. The food is excellent, and after a long day at work, it is a real advantage not to have to look elsewhere for a good meal.

Basera Boutique Hotel is an exceptional place to stay in Kathmandu. It enjoys a wonderful location in a peaceful and beautiful neighbourhood, while remaining conveniently close to the city’s main sights. The hotel combines elegance and comfort with a discreet sense of luxury, creating an atmosphere that feels refined yet genuinely welcoming. Its architecture is particularly impressive, drawing beautifully on the traditional Newar style of the Kathmandu Valley. This gives Basera a distinctive character and a strong sense of place, far removed from the anonymity of a conventional international hotel. My room was spacious, quiet and extremely comfortable, and the airport transfers in both directions were seamless and very convenient. The food was consistently delicious, with an excellent selection of Nepali and Indian dishes alongside very well-prepared international cuisine. Above all, the staff was unfailingly courteous, attentive and helpful throughout my stay. Their warmth and professionalism contributed enormously to the experience. I would recommend Basera Boutique Hotel without hesitation to anyone seeking comfort, tranquillity, excellent hospitality and an authentic touch of Kathmandu’s architectural heritage. I very much hope to return.
